SUCCESS, finally got my system install....now bass questions
On my headunit, I have a subwoofer control. I can switch between 50hz, 80hz and 125hz.
Which would be the best frequency to use??
Headunit is a Pioneer DEH P-736
Amp is MTX Pro50X2
Woofer is 10 inch Kaption

When I played around with the controls, 80hz gives the most bass and 125hz is not bass at all but 50hz seems to gives the lowest volume in sound. Is it because the songs I listen to don't use 50hz and mostly 80 hz?
the louder bass on a system is usullay between 80-100, anything under 40 is inaudible u can only feel it, usually the bass gets louder from 50-100 or a little higher then slants off again. It all depends on what music you listen to
Wow... let's try some other stuff shall we?
1st, what kind of box is it? Sealed? Ported? Bandpass?
40Hz isn't inaudible. The human ear can hear 10Hz up to something like 18Khz.
I say go 120, and check the crossover on the amp ( could be why you have "no bass at all" )
